Former 3rd Strike Frontman Jim Korthe Dies

by | Jan 25, 2010

According to The Daily Breeze, former 3rd Strike frontman, Jim Korthe, died Wednesday (January 20) at his home in San Pedro, California. He was 39 years old.

“He was under a doctor’s care. He had gotten really sick around Christmas,” said his sister, Lynda Walter. “They could not figure out what was wrong.”
 
The Coroner’s Office said his cause of death was deferred, pending toxicology tests. Further information can be found here.
